What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Philadelphia to San Jose?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Philadelphia to San Jose cl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

If your flying dates are flexible, you should consider flying to San Jose on a Tuesday, as we generally find the cheapest rates on that day for this route. On the other hand, Sunday is the most expensive day to fly from Philadelphia to San Jose. For your return ticket, we recommend flying on a Wednesday and avoiding Sundays for the best deals.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Philadelphia to San Jose?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Philadelphia to San Jose,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Philadelphia to San Jose is September, where tickets cost $276 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are June and May,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$396 and $377 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Philadelphia to San Jose?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Philadelphia to San Jose,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Philadelphia to San Jose, you should book around 4 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 17 weeks before departure.

  • Does PHL Airport allow pets?

    Yes. There is a pet-relief area located at different terminals within the airport. They are found both outdoors and indoors. Your pet is given proper care while at the relief-are. You can play with your pet in the grassy area. You should contact the airport to inquire about security screening.

  • Are there art exhibitions at PHL Airport?

    Yes. An exhibition within the airport shows the cultural background of the Philadelphians. You can enjoy art while at the airport as you wait for the departure time of your flight. There are several paintings that you can enjoy looking at. Sculpture and artifacts are available too.

  • Are there services for persons with limited mobility at SJC Airport?

    Yes. There is a ramp and an elevator that you can use to easily access other floors without struggling. The airport offers wheelchair assistance to guests with limited mobility. You need to book the service online to ensure the wheelchair s availed on your arrival at the airport.

  • Does San Jose Airport offer services to corporate travelers?

    Yes. There is a business center located within the airport. Here, you can get facilities for meeting clients, brand launching and organizing seminars. KAYAK’s top tips for finding a cheap flight from Philadelphia to San Jose

  • Philadelphia International Airport (PHL) offers parking facilities to departing travelers arriving with cars. You can book parking before the day of travel to ensure you get the service. Self-park is available to ensure you park your car in a comfortable place. Long-term parking is available for travelers on a long vacation. Valet parking ensures you do not go through the stress of looking for a place to park.
  • PHL Airport offers nursing facilities to lactating mothers. Mamava Suite is located at Terminal A and ensures security and privacy while breastfeeding your baby. A power supply is available to enable you to pump milk for your baby while still at the airport. You can change your baby's diaper at the available changing table.
  • PHL Airport has lounges within its terminals. The Centurion Lounge is available at Terminal A of the Airport. USO Lounge is at Terminal A and is usually open for 24 hours. Snacks and drinks are available at the lounges to ensure you do not wait for the flight on an empty stomach. You can go through the magazines and newspapers available at the airport.
  • San Jose International Airport (SJC) offers transport facilities to travelers arriving at the airport. There is a bus located at the terminal. It has a frequency of 5 minutes. It operates from 4 am to 11 pm to ensure all travelers access the service. A taxi is available for hire. Ensure that the taxi you hire has a driver.
  • SJC Airport offers car rental services to arriving travelers. There are several car rental agencies within the airport. Economy, Payless and Dollar ensure you get the service on arrival at the airport. You need to book online for the service to ensure there are no inconveniences on your arrival at the airport.
